WebHow many hours long is school in China? The school hours depend on the grade and the area, but, usually, kids start their days at 7:30 or 8:00 and finish at about 17:00. The … Web10 aug. 2024 · The average school day runs from 7:30 a.m. to 5 p.m., with a two-hour lunch break. The school system in China requires nine years of education. High school …

WebSchool Hours. Children attend school five days a week. The school hours depend on the grade and the area, but, usually, kids start their days at 7:30 or 8:00 and finish at about … WebOn a typical school day, school starts at 07:30 with a reading session followed by the morning exercise and then four 45-minute class periods ending at noon.
